// GRID_SEED_RETRIES: max attempts Latticeworks makes to seed a valid
// crossword grid before falling back to the cached template pool.
// Set to 40. Lower values ship faster but produce duplicate-heavy
// puzzles; QA flagged this in the Thistledown release. Do not bump
// past 60 — generation time blows the 2s budget on shared workers.
// Any change here must be noted in release notes with the artifact
// token, which appears below.

trace token, kahog-tajeg: htk6_97d963

## Formula sandbox tuning

User-supplied formulas in Gridmoor execute inside a restricted interpreter with hard ceilings on time, memory, and call depth. Reviewers should confirm any change to these ceilings is justified in the PR description, since raising them widens the abuse surface. Defaults were chosen from production traces. The current limits are as follows.

limits module of tafog-fawip:
WEIGHTS = {
    "julix": 57,
    "lamys": 992,
    "kasvan": 209,
    "quenok": 750,
    "alddor": 259,
    "oliath": 1009,
    "wenix": 815,
}

Capacity note for the Bramblewick export retry queue. Failed exports are requeued with exponential backoff, and the queue depth is our main capacity signal: sustained depth above the high-water mark means downstream Pellis storage is saturated, not that we need more workers. As the new contractor, please don't raise worker counts without checking storage latency first — it usually makes things worse. Retry timing, backoff caps, and the high-water threshold are all driven by the constants shown below.

limits module of yagef-bajog:
TIERS = {
    "druael": 370,
    "tamix": 286,
    "pelius": 541,
    "pelael": 78,
    "pelox": 47,
    "ralath": 533,
    "drumir": 801,
}

Leadership Review Briefing — Q3 Cash-Flow Forecast

Branch managers should note that Hollybrook Mercantile's Q3 forecast shows a modest surplus, driven by stronger receivables collection at the Dunmere and Aldercote branches. Outflows remain elevated due to the warehouse refit at Pellwick. Contingency reserves are adequate but should not be drawn without regional sign-off. Please review before Thursday's session, where the following point will be discussed.

internal memo for fajog-yagaf: Gross margin on Ulaael came in at 20 percent against a plan of 10 percent. Only 9 of the 80 pilot accounts renewed Ulaael, so a churn review is set for July 1.